IS -2.5 + (-3.5) = -6

Answer: Yes

Step-by-step explanation: When using two negatives, the numbers absolute value grows bigger ,as if it was two positives. 2.5 + 3.5 is the same as -2.5 + (-3.5), except you would add a negative to the beginning of the number.
